My Main Buying Factors
1. Heating Power
The first thing I looked at was how much space the heater could warm. For me, it was important to choose a model that could handle a small room, tent, workshop, or cabin area. I paid attention to the BTU rating because that told me how powerful the heater was and whether it would meet my needs.
2. Portability
I wanted a heater I could move easily. The Big Buddy Pro Heater appealed to me because it is designed to be carried and used in different places. If I am buying a portable heater, I always check the weight, handle design, and how easy it is to store when not in use.
3. Fuel Type and Runtime
I made sure to consider what kind of fuel the heater uses and how long it can run. For me, a good heater should not only perform well but also last long enough for practical use. I looked for a model with decent runtime so I would not need to replace fuel too often.
4. Safety Features
Safety was a major concern for me. I checked for features like automatic shutoff, tip-over protection, and oxygen depletion safety systems. Since I may use the heater indoors or in enclosed spaces, I wanted peace of mind that the heater would help reduce risks.
5. Ease of Use
I prefer products that are simple to operate. With a heater, I want easy ignition, clear controls, and straightforward maintenance. The less time I spend figuring it out, the better my experience is.
6. Durability
I also wanted something that felt sturdy and well-built. A heater is an investment, so I looked for solid construction and reliable materials. In my experience, durability matters a lot if I plan to use the heater regularly or carry it around often.

What I Would Watch Out For
Even though I like the heater, I would still pay attention to a few things before buying:
- Whether the heater is suitable for my exact space size
- How much fuel I will need for regular use
- Proper ventilation requirements
- Any local restrictions on indoor fuel-burning heaters
